DBA Data[Home] [Help]

APPS.GME_CREATE_STEP_PVT dependencies on FM_TEXT_TBL

Line 2983: CURSOR fm_text_tbl_cursor (p_text_code fm_text_tbl.text_code%TYPE)

2979: l_text_table gme_common_pvt.text_tab;
2980: l_api_name CONSTANT VARCHAR2 (30) := 'copy and create text';
2981: unexpected_error EXCEPTION;
2982:
2983: CURSOR fm_text_tbl_cursor (p_text_code fm_text_tbl.text_code%TYPE)
2984: IS
2985: SELECT *
2986: FROM fm_text_tbl
2987: WHERE text_code = p_text_code

Line 2986: FROM fm_text_tbl

2982:
2983: CURSOR fm_text_tbl_cursor (p_text_code fm_text_tbl.text_code%TYPE)
2984: IS
2985: SELECT *
2986: FROM fm_text_tbl
2987: WHERE text_code = p_text_code
2988: ORDER BY line_no;
2989: BEGIN
2990: IF g_debug <= gme_debug.g_log_procedure THEN

Line 3010: FOR l_fm_text_tbl_row IN fm_text_tbl_cursor (p_gmd_text_code) LOOP

3006: IF (l_return) THEN
3007: x_gme_text_code := l_text_header.text_code;
3008:
3009: -- This fetches using the fm text data based on the fm text code.
3010: FOR l_fm_text_tbl_row IN fm_text_tbl_cursor (p_gmd_text_code) LOOP
3011: l_number_of_text_lines := l_number_of_text_lines + 1;
3012: l_text_table (l_number_of_text_lines).text_code :=
3013: x_gme_text_code;
3014: l_text_table (l_number_of_text_lines).line_no :=

Line 3015: l_fm_text_tbl_row.line_no;

3011: l_number_of_text_lines := l_number_of_text_lines + 1;
3012: l_text_table (l_number_of_text_lines).text_code :=
3013: x_gme_text_code;
3014: l_text_table (l_number_of_text_lines).line_no :=
3015: l_fm_text_tbl_row.line_no;
3016: l_text_table (l_number_of_text_lines).lang_code :=
3017: l_fm_text_tbl_row.lang_code;
3018: l_text_table (l_number_of_text_lines).paragraph_code :=
3019: l_fm_text_tbl_row.paragraph_code;

Line 3017: l_fm_text_tbl_row.lang_code;

3013: x_gme_text_code;
3014: l_text_table (l_number_of_text_lines).line_no :=
3015: l_fm_text_tbl_row.line_no;
3016: l_text_table (l_number_of_text_lines).lang_code :=
3017: l_fm_text_tbl_row.lang_code;
3018: l_text_table (l_number_of_text_lines).paragraph_code :=
3019: l_fm_text_tbl_row.paragraph_code;
3020: l_text_table (l_number_of_text_lines).sub_paracode :=
3021: l_fm_text_tbl_row.sub_paracode;

Line 3019: l_fm_text_tbl_row.paragraph_code;

3015: l_fm_text_tbl_row.line_no;
3016: l_text_table (l_number_of_text_lines).lang_code :=
3017: l_fm_text_tbl_row.lang_code;
3018: l_text_table (l_number_of_text_lines).paragraph_code :=
3019: l_fm_text_tbl_row.paragraph_code;
3020: l_text_table (l_number_of_text_lines).sub_paracode :=
3021: l_fm_text_tbl_row.sub_paracode;
3022:
3023: IF (l_fm_text_tbl_row.line_no = -1) THEN

Line 3021: l_fm_text_tbl_row.sub_paracode;

3017: l_fm_text_tbl_row.lang_code;
3018: l_text_table (l_number_of_text_lines).paragraph_code :=
3019: l_fm_text_tbl_row.paragraph_code;
3020: l_text_table (l_number_of_text_lines).sub_paracode :=
3021: l_fm_text_tbl_row.sub_paracode;
3022:
3023: IF (l_fm_text_tbl_row.line_no = -1) THEN
3024: l_text_table (l_number_of_text_lines).text := p_text_string;
3025: ELSE

Line 3023: IF (l_fm_text_tbl_row.line_no = -1) THEN

3019: l_fm_text_tbl_row.paragraph_code;
3020: l_text_table (l_number_of_text_lines).sub_paracode :=
3021: l_fm_text_tbl_row.sub_paracode;
3022:
3023: IF (l_fm_text_tbl_row.line_no = -1) THEN
3024: l_text_table (l_number_of_text_lines).text := p_text_string;
3025: ELSE
3026: l_text_table (l_number_of_text_lines).text :=
3027: l_fm_text_tbl_row.text;

Line 3027: l_fm_text_tbl_row.text;

3023: IF (l_fm_text_tbl_row.line_no = -1) THEN
3024: l_text_table (l_number_of_text_lines).text := p_text_string;
3025: ELSE
3026: l_text_table (l_number_of_text_lines).text :=
3027: l_fm_text_tbl_row.text;
3028:
3029: IF (NVL (g_debug, -1) = gme_debug.g_log_statement) THEN
3030: gme_debug.put_line
3031: ( 'text for line no '

Line 3032: || l_fm_text_tbl_row.line_no

3028:
3029: IF (NVL (g_debug, -1) = gme_debug.g_log_statement) THEN
3030: gme_debug.put_line
3031: ( 'text for line no '
3032: || l_fm_text_tbl_row.line_no
3033: || ' is '
3034: || l_text_table (l_number_of_text_lines).text);
3035: END IF;
3036: END IF;

Line 3038: /* FOR l_fm_text_tbl_row in fm_text_tbl_cursor(l_text_code) LOOP */

3034: || l_text_table (l_number_of_text_lines).text);
3035: END IF;
3036: END IF;
3037: END LOOP;
3038: /* FOR l_fm_text_tbl_row in fm_text_tbl_cursor(l_text_code) LOOP */
3039: ELSE
3040: -- We could not insert the text header. Error message pushed on stack in dbl code.
3041: RAISE unexpected_error;
3042: END IF;